However there is similar requirement when we are paused during postcopy migration. The old incoming channel might have been destroyed already. We may need another new channel for the recovery to happen. This patch leveraged the same interface, but allows the user to specify incoming migration channel even for paused postcopy. Meanwhile, now migration listening ports are always detached manually using the tag, rather than using return values of dispatchers.
